Tactical Obstacle Racing
Nuclear Fallout is an obstacle course race held in Brentwood, Essex. The event takes place on a permanent course situated on rugged farmland and woodland, featuring a variety of terrain including lakes, bogs, and muddy ditches. Participants navigate a mix of natural and man-made obstacles designed to test strength, agility, and endurance.
The event offers three distinct distance options to accommodate different experience levels:
- 6 km: Includes over 40 obstacles and is open to participants aged 14 and over.
- 12 km: Features over 70 obstacles and is open to participants aged 16 and over.
- 24 km+ (Oblivion MAXX): An multi-lap endurance format consisting of three or more laps of the course, featuring over 200 obstacles in total.
Course Features and Facilities
The course includes signature elements such as the Deathslide, a 20-foot slide, alongside woodland trails and water-based challenges. Buoyancy aids are available for participants during water obstacles. The event is chip-timed, and results are available on the day of the race.
Participants have access to on-site facilities including a hot washdown area, changing rooms, a secure bag drop, and a free car park. An event village is established for spectators, offering music, food, and drinks. Professional photographers are stationed along the course to capture action shots and finisher photos.
